#f0449d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0449d is composed of 94.1% red, 26.7%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#f0449d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#e1003b.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f0449d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0449d has RGB values of R:240, G:68,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.35,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15746205.

Shades and Tints of #f0449d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0107 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0449d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b999a is the less saturated color, while #f83c9d is the most saturated one.
